schedule appliances

A clear example of how you can use home automation to save on your electricity bill while you are away from home is being able to program household appliances. Especially if you have a contracted rate with hourly discrimination , you will be able to take advantage of it to connect devices at the hours when it is cheaper.

But of course, you will not always be at home to turn on the dishwasher or put the washing machine on when it is cheaper. Thanks to home automation you will be able to program the devices at those times or even turn them on directly from your mobile phone even if you are away from home. You just need to have these appliances automated.

lower or raise blinds

You will also be able to raise or lower blinds at home, even if you are working outside or in any other place. This can also be useful to save energy in certain circumstances. You will be able to do all this thanks to your mobile phone, as long as you have automated blinds.

But how does it help save energy? Think of a sunny day, with a good temperature and you have left the blinds down because the night before it was raining or it was very windy. You can take advantage of the sun and the good temperature of that day in the morning so that the house warms up a bit and you don’t have to turn on the heating later or, at least, that you don’t start from such a low temperature.

Optimize the use of heating or air

Another use that you will be able to give home automation is to optimize the use of both heating and air conditioning . Maybe you want to maintain a temperature, but you are going to leave the house for a while and you do not want the house to be completely cold when you return. Once again, you will be able to use home automation for this and not have to leave the heating on.

What you’re going to do is turn it on for a while before you get home. You’ll have a nice temperature when you arrive, but you don’t need to have it on for hours beforehand; only the necessary time.

Turn off forgotten lights or appliances

Perhaps you have left a light on or you think you left some device on before you left. Home automation allows you to have information about it and to be able to turn off an appliance if necessary or to configure it to save energy. From outside the home you will be able to do it simply by having the Internet on your mobile.

Therefore, saving light outside the home by being able to turn off forgotten appliances is possible thanks to a smart home. You can also use plugs with Wi-Fi to disconnect devices of all kinds from the electrical network.

Receive open window or door alerts

Has a window been opened with the air? Have you left a door open and it is getting cold in winter? There are sensors that alert you to this and you receive information on your mobile, no matter where you are. This is also useful for security, to prevent intruders from entering.

If there is an open window, it can mean that the heating is wasting energy or that the house cools down and you have to heat it later, which means that you are going to consume more.
